Just Al is a 7 year old bay gelding. Just Al is trained by A D Fuller, at Tauranga and owned by S B Cunningham & Mrs S H Fuller.
Just Al’s last race event was at 13/07/2022 and it has not been nominated for any upcoming race.
Career form is wins, seconds, 2 thirds from 15 starts with a lifetime career prize money of $4,900.
With a 0% Win Percentage and 13% Place Percentage. Just Al's last race event was at Cambridge.
Exposed form for its last starts is 6-9-9-0-0.
